While I'd forgotten that All My Children had a lesbian character in the
80's, you might also want to know that there are currently two gay regular
characters and two other occasional ones:
 
        Kevin--a college student.  This is an elaborate storyline over the last
two years.  But to sum it up, his older brother is in prison for a murder
which occurred when Kevin came out on a talk show and his brother went ape
and tried to kill Kevin's supportive, openly gay high school history
teacher but missed and killed the teacher's sister instead (see below).
After this storyline, Kevin tried to reconcile with his wealthy but
neglectful parents, but only managed to work things out with his mother,
who left his father over it.  Kevin also went through a period when he
tried to be straight, including going to one of those "recovery"
therapists, but finally is comfortable with his homosexuality.  This whole
thing was handled very well by the writers:  not sugary and not condemning
or self-righteous.  He was confused, and coming out was hard, but now he's
even dating.
 
        Waiter--interested in Kevin and went out with him on at least one date.
Kevin's first gay sexual experience.
 
        Mike--high school history teacher (with Ph.D.).  Faced prejudice and an
attempt to get him fired when he came out, but he persisted and kept his
job.  Also faced resistance from his brother-in-law, who eventually came
around and is now a close and supportive friend.  His supportive sister was
killed, as described above.  Has recently had a much more minor role on the
show, but pops up occasionally.  Has a long-term partner, Brad, a doctor.
 
        Brad--a doctor and Mike's long-term partner.  Hasn't been on the show in
awhile.
